光敏核不育水稻开花和育性转变不同的光反应; Different photoresponses of flowering and fertility alteration in photoperiod-sensitive genie male-sterile rice
王伟 ; 陈亮
1999
关键词水稻 育性 开花 光周期反应 Oryza sativa fertility flowering photoperiodic responses
英文摘要从光敏核不育水稻“农垦585“幼穗分化至二次枝梗期开始,在每天的短日照光期(10H日光)结束、暗期开始时(EOd)进行15d的远红光(fr)照射实验,以比较开花、育性转变过程对短暂的远红光(fr)或红光(r)的反应。EOdfr明显抑制水稻植株开花(穗分化),导致“农垦585“和原种“农垦58“的抽穗期均比短日照下推退7d,表现为长日照效应,而“农垦58S“的结实率与原种相比却无显著变化。这暗示诱导农垦58S开花、育性转变过程的光反应可能有差异,前者不仅与光周期有关,且受EOdfr的剧烈影响,而育性主要受光周期(临界暗期)控制,基本上不受EOdfr的调控。; Photoresponses of flowering (panicle development) and fertility alteration of photoperiod-sensitive genie male-sterile rice "Nongken 58S" were compared after brief end-of-day (EOD) far-red light (FR) or red light (R) irradiation.From secondary rachis-branch primordia differentiation on, EOD experiments were Performed following 10 h of natural sunlight for successive 15 d.The heading date of "Nongken 58S"plants delayed for 7 d (long-day effect) by EOD FR,whereas its fertility had little or no change relative to the original-line rice "Nongken 58".These results implied that in" Nongken 585" plants photoperiod response mediating fertility alteration somewhat differed from that required by flowering.; 国家自然科学基金!39800087
